Why Uranium and Nuclear Energy Are Gaining Traction

Nuclear power is increasingly seen as a cornerstone of the clean energy transition, offering a low-carbon alternative to fossil fuels. Countries around the world are extending the life of existing reactors and commissioning new ones, creating a sustained demand for uranium. This structural shift has made uranium mining companies like Ur Energy attractive to institutional investors seeking long-term growth.

Moreover, the recent rally in uranium prices has been supported by production cuts from major miners and a tightening global supply. This supply-demand imbalance has led analysts to project higher prices in the coming years, making early investments potentially lucrative.
